Generations of effective video gaming console releases through the years led to the much-hyped 1996 launch of Nintendo 64, a system that represented a huge evolutionary leap in video game technology. Times are a' changin' and the system's ever-growing library of titles has expanded into every genre of video games imaginable, including video games better-suited for older gamers. And with newer game systems including CD-based video games, the system's pricey cartridge format is showing itself an antiquated and unconventional storage format.
